How to improve single-phase self-adaptive reclosing of high-voltage AC transmission line on the inverter side

To provide an improvement method of a single-phase self-adaptive reclosing circuit of a high-voltage ac transmission line on the inverter side.SOLUTION: A single-phase self-adaptive reclosing circuit of an overhead transmission line uses a current transformer to acquire a voltage of an inverter side current transformer bus in real time when a single-phase ground failure occurs, and uses a high-speed Fourier algorithm to calculate a voltage amplitude value U of the current transformer bus and calculate ΔU as a difference between a peak value and a valley value after the single-phase ground failure of the AC system on the inverter side has occurred, and the trip occurs. The ΔU and a set value G are compared, and the single-phase self-adaptive reclosing circuit is closed when the ΔU is larger than the set value G, and the single-phase self-adaptive reclosing circuit is opened when the ΔU is smaller than the set value G to distinguish a temporary failure and a permanent failure.SELECTED DRAWING: Figure 1
